29th Annual Father’s Day Smoke & Steam Show
Sunday, June 21st ~ 10:00 am - 4:00 pm

Enjoy the Kawarthas’ original tractor show!
Featuring:
- Tractor and wagon rides
- Engine displays
- Traditional music by Appalachian Celtic
- Demonstrations by the Peterborough Artisan Centre Wood Turners & Kawartha Woodturners Guild
- Bewdley Lions Club Food Truck selling lunch and breakfast ($- CASH ONLY)
- Craft area
- Natural dyeing demonstration
- Tractor games and slow races beginning at 12 noon
- Old-fashioned schoolyard games
- Empire Cheese curd, fresh bread, and pickles for sale in the Cheese Factory ($)
- Freshly popped kettle corn by Ben’s Kettle Corn ($)
- Rope-making demonstration
- Grinding demonstrations at the Lang Grist Mill
- Sweet treats and refreshments (including old-fashioned bottled sodas) are available for purchase at the Keene Hotel ($)
- Pie-eating contest on the Village Green at 2 pm (limited spaces available)
- Model train display
- Pancakes on a stick by Lea’s Creations ($)
- Junior Conductor kits for purchase for little ones, which include a conductor’s hat, bandana, and wooden train whistle ($)
- Tractor parade through the historic village beginning at 3:15 pm
Visitors are encouraged to bring cash as there is no ATM on-site.
Admission: Adults- $17, Students & Seniors (60+) – $12, Youths 5 to 14 Years of Age – $9, Free for Children Under 5 Years of Age, Family Pass (includes 2 Adults and up to 4 Youths) – $45

Meet Our 2026 Smoke & Steam Show Ambassador – Meg Sturgeon
Meg Sturgeon is a grade 11 student at Thomas A. Stewart Secondary School in Peterborough. For the past 15 years she has been a dedicated volunteer at Lang Pioneer Village Museum, taking on a number of roles. Some of her favorites include teaching visitors historical games on the village green, cooking and baking over an open hearth in the Fitzpatrick, leading crafts in the Ayotte cabin and interpreting in many of the buildings in the village. Meg is also an active air cadet with 534 Raider RCACS, where she holds the positions of social media manager and drill team commander. She loves drawing, hiking, and cooking. Meg is looking forward to welcoming everyone to Lang Pioneer Village Museum’s 29th Annual Father’s Day Smoke & Steam Show.
